DALLAS — The family of a Venezuelan man shot during an attack on a Dallas immigration facility says they first learned of his injuries through social media and remain desperate for answers.
Jose Andres Bordones-Molina, 33, was one of three men shot at the facility last week . He was the only survivor. His parents, who live in Venezuela, said they viewed surveillance footage of the facility on social media, and they were able to identify their son running into the building with bloodied shorts.
“We feel so worried... we’re in distress,” his father, Jose Bordones, said in Spanish during an interview with WFAA. “What’s going to happen to my son?”
